Transaction 64d93ebbc00d8399ab18c64bf80ec7dfab64aca77914d16303100dfb6a5bdce3

1 Input
2 Outputs
  • 64d93ebbc00d8399ab18c64bf80ec7dfab64aca77914d16303100dfb6a5bdce3:0
  • value  66100
    address  16dHbxCHEuqjKQWwXwVWM2ShLXsR2xJMFs
  • 64d93ebbc00d8399ab18c64bf80ec7dfab64aca77914d16303100dfb6a5bdce3:1
  • value  6343022
    address  34gKJCtUnTqGQPEedjHMzwZBAwp9UFxNbR